JQuery中each()的使用方法说明

下面是JQuery中each()的使用方法说明的完整攻略。

简介

JQuery中的each()方法是一个通用的迭代函数,可用于遍历、循环和操作数组和对象。使用该方法,可以轻松地遍历数组或对象中的所有元素,并对每个元素进行操作。

语法

$.each( obj, function( index, value ) {
  //回调函数
});

参数说明:

  • obj:必需,表示待遍历的数组或对象。
  • function( index, value ):必需,表示回调函数,其中index表示当前元素在数组或对象中的索引,value表示当前元素的值。

示例

例1. 遍历数组

var arr = [ "a", "b", "c" ];
$.each( arr, function( index, value ) {
  console.log( index + ": " + value );
});

输出结果:

0: a
1: b
2: c

在这个例子中,我们定义了一个包含三个字符串的数组,然后使用each()方法遍历该数组。在遍历的过程中,回调函数接受当前元素在数组中的索引和该元素的值,随后输出到控制台中。

例2. 遍历对象

var obj = {
  name: "John",
  age: 30,
  city: "New York"
};
$.each( obj, function( key, value ) {
  console.log( key + ": " + value );
});

输出结果:

name: John
age: 30
city: New York

在这个例子中,我们定义了一个包含三个属性的对象,然后使用each()方法遍历该对象。在遍历的过程中,回调函数接受当前属性的名称和该属性的值,随后输出到控制台中。

总结

以上就是JQuery中each()方法的使用方法说明,它可以很方便地遍历数组和对象,并对每个元素进行操作。通过实际应用,可以更好地理解和掌握该方法的使用。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:JQuery中each()的使用方法说明 - Python技术站

(0)
上一篇 2023年5月19日
下一篇 2023年5月19日

相关文章

  • 通过Jquery的Ajax方法读取将table转换为Json

    将table转换为JSON有许多方式,其中一种常用的是使用JQuery的Ajax方法。以下是详细的攻略: 步骤一:编写HTML文件 首先,需要编写一个HTML文件。在其中,需要一个table元素,并赋值id属性为”myData”,如下所示: <!DOCTYPE html> <html lang="en"> <…

    jquery 2023年5月27日
    00
  • jQWidgets jqxDropDownButton dropDownVerticalAlignment属性

    jQWidgets 的 jqxDropDownButton 组件是一个带有下拉菜单的按钮控件。dropDownVerticalAlignment 属性可以用于控制下拉菜单的垂直对齐方式。本攻略中,我们将详细讲解如何使用 dropDownVerticalAlignment 属性,并提供两个示例说明。 步骤1:创建一个 jqxDropDownButton 首先,…

    jquery 2023年5月10日
    00
  • JQuery 小练习(实例代码)

    我会详细讲解一下 “JQuery 小练习(实例代码)” 的完整攻略。下面是整个过程的步骤: 1. 准备工作 首先我们需要准备 JQuery 库,可以从 JQuery 官网 下载最新版的 JQuery。下载后,将其引入到 HTML 页面中: <script src="jquery.min.js"></script> …

    jquery 2023年5月27日
    00
  • jQuery与JS加载事件用法分析

    jQuery与JS加载事件用法分析 在开发网页时,我们经常需要使用JavaScript和jQuery来完成各种操作。然而,这些操作需要在正确的时间和顺序下进行,否则将导致代码出错或效果不佳。因此,我们需要了解JS和jQuery的加载事件用法来确保代码执行顺序和正确性。 JS加载事件用法分析 onload事件 当网页的所有资源(包括图片、音频等)全部加载完成后…

    jquery 2023年5月28日
    00
  • 如何使用JavaScript/jQuery创建自动调整大小的textarea

    关于如何使用JavaScript/jQuery创建自动调整大小的textarea,一般需要用到以下几个步骤: 1. 使用HTML创建一个textarea元素 首先要在HTML代码中创建一个textarea元素,其中要注意设置该元素的class或id,以便在后续使用JavaScript或jQuery操作该元素。该元素的样式可以根据实际需求进行设置。 <!…

    jquery 2023年5月12日
    00
  • jQuery focus()方法

    jQuery focus()方法用于将焦点设置到指定元素上。该方法通常用于在页面加载时自动将焦点设置到某个元素上,或在用户执行某些操作后将点设置到另一个元素上。 以下是jQuery focus()方法的详细攻略: 语法 $(selector).focus() 参数 无 示例1:自动设置焦点 以下示例演示了如何使用jQuery focus()方法在页面加载时自…

    jquery 2023年5月9日
    00
  • jQWidgets jqxComboBox getVisibleItems()方法

    jQWidgets 的 jqxComboBox 组件提供了 getVisibleItems() 方法,用于获取下拉列表中可见的项。本文将详细介绍 getVisibleItems() 方法的使用方法,包括方法概述、示例以及注意事项。 getVisibleItems() 方法概述 getVisibleItems() 方法用于获取下拉列表中可见的项。该方法返回一个…

    jquery 2023年5月11日
    00
  • jQuery andSelf()的例子

    下面是关于jQuery中andSelf()方法的详细攻略。 什么是andSelf()方法? 在jQuery中,andSelf()方法是用于将当前选中的元素和上一个选择器的所有元素合并为一个集合的方法。它返回与前一个选择器相匹配的元素及其前一个状态的元素,一起形成一个新的集合。它可以用于链接选择器或链式方法中,以便修改或遍历这些元素。 andSelf()方法的…

    jquery 2023年5月12日
    00
合作推广
合作推广
分享本页
返回顶部